Output 63eb50643dbbde967c56d634838ef49a492a0fd4bcf2839513b433d28ab093f6:3

value
38323
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3da658b18f7f32f46a363e553944b4237ab4252 OP_EQUALVERIFY OP_CHECKSIG
address
1PENq5fC1Bh2esYUk6S1woTNUxEX5vxDiU
transaction
63eb50643dbbde967c56d634838ef49a492a0fd4bcf2839513b433d28ab093f6
spent
true